Abstract
The utility model discloses a fitness dance training auxiliary system based on an action identification technique. The system comprises a main machine, a displayer, a round dancing pad and sleeved loops worn on the limbs of a human body. Four stand columns are arranged evenly along the periphery of the dancing pad, a top base is arranged at the top end of each stand column, a camera is arranged on the top portion of the top base, a proximity sensor is arranged on the bottom portion of the top base, a central processing unit and a wireless module are respectively arranged inside the top base, the proximity sensor is connected to the central processing unit, and the central processing unit, an inertia measuring unit and the wireless module are arranged inside each sleeved loop. The system is high in simulation precision and truth degree and capable of effectively assisting athletes in conducting fitness dance training and improves training effect.

In the utility model, wave motion images and be sent to main frame by the camera acquisition human health, obtain the human limb exercise data and be sent to respectively main frame by Inertial Measurement Unit in the collar, main frame simulates the human health by the image that sends and data and waves motion picture on display, the proximity transducer in footstock is measured the human body kick whether standard is judged so that main frame is to the human body kick simultaneously.The utility model simulation precision and validity are high, and effectively synkinesia person carries out Fitness Dance and trains and improve training effect.
